Friday, February 3, 2012Hi CSA Members--- First I want to welcome all of our new members of which there are many and welcome back all returning members, we are looking forward to the coming season and even now we are busy getting ready for the season. We are well on our way to reaching our goal for membership this year but can still take some more, so if you have anyone you know that would like to get on board encourage them to do so soon, so they don’t get left out. We are getting some of the field prep going but with the cold nights we are having to wait until later in the day to get started but still have lots to do outside the fields as well. We have all of our seed ordered (I think) although some of it will not come until later when the time for planting comes around, seed potatoes, straw berries and that kind of thing. However, we have to get them ordered early or they likely would not be available. Also have ordered most of the irrigation supplies so we can get all we need there as well. We have some things going in the greenhouse and will start more this week. Seems a little hard to think it is time already but to get things early that is what it takes. We have increased our acreage this year from 10 to about 14 so that is a pretty big jump. Of course this will also mean we will need increase our work force. We expect to get the two men we had last year back and add a third one who worked a few weeks for us last year. All of them were good, hard working men and I didn’t have to be concerned whether they would slack off if I wasn’t around. So we are glad for that. We will be attending a couple of conferences this month regarding farming that applies to our operation as we need to continue to learn and get new ideas to be better at what we do. We’ll be in Spokane for a two day conference that keys in on growing stronger healthier plants by building the soils. Then a one day conference in Corvallis that keys in on the needs of small farms, thus called the “Small Farms Conference”. These are two that we go to each year and each year come back with new ideas, some that get tried and others that may be yet in the future to try.
